Wolves in advanced talks for Kalajdzic​

Wolves are in advanced negotiations with Stuttgart over a deal for striker Sasha Kalajdzic - who was on Manchester United's list of possible targets earlier this month.

Sky Sports News has been told that Wolves and the Bundesliga club are still some distance away in terms of valuation.

Wolves have indicated they're prepared to pay £15m for the 6ft 7in Austrian international, but Stuttgart are currently asking for £21.1m (Є25m).

It's not thought personal terms would be an issue with the player, who is keen on a move to the Premier League.

Kaladjzic has a year left to run on his current Stuttgart contract.
